Full Job Description


Description

We are hiring a Principal-level Environmental Consultant to help lead and grow our Portland, Oregon office. The ideal candidate is a technical expert and practicing environmental professional who can build lasting client relationships, manage teams, and serve as a strategic leader in private-sector remediation projects.

The Role
  • Serve as a trusted advisor and technical lead for clients in the private sector (developers, attorneys).
  • Identify and pursue new business opportunities
  • Lead and mentor junior and mid-level staff.
  • Oversee operations in collaboration with regional leadership.
  • Provide direction on regulatory strategies and field execution.


Who are you
  • 15+ years of experience in environmental consulting, with an emphasis in remediation, due diligence, or site redevelopment.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ead multidisciplinary project teams and maintain high standards of quality, safety, and compliance.
  • Track record of building and sustaining client relationships, with a proactive and consultative approach.
  • Entrepreneurial mindset with the drive to shape a regional office's success through client development and leadership.
  • Strong communication, emotional intelligence, and a collaborative leadership style aligned with Terraphase's culture.
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Environmental Science, Geology, Engineering, or a related field.


Compensation for this position is based on years of experience, technical expertise, technical education, and geographic location.

Pay Range

$145,000-$200,000 USD

Benefits

Terraphase offers an extensive benefits package including; Medical, Dental, Vision, Employer Paid Life Insurance, Long-Term Disability, a generous 401(k) match, Commuter Benefits, TerraLunches, TerraTalks, Tuition/Licensing/Professional Development Reimbursement, Flexible Work Schedule, ongoing company-sponsored events.
